Roomba S9+ The Roomba S9+ is equipped with a suite modern technologies that offer an exceptional clean. It is 40% bigger dual brushes that can adapt to floor surfaces and prevent getting tangled with pet hair. It also has a HEPA filter to keep allergens in check. It's simple to schedule cleaning times using the iRobot app or your voice assistant (Alexa, Google Home, or Siri). The Roomba S9+ is the best robot vacuum in our lab tests for both bare floors and carpets. It can easily pick up dirt such as cereal and rice on floors that are unfinished and is a great choice for low-pile carpet. Because of its D-shaped design it is able to easily remove dirt and debris that is in corners and isn't stuck to furniture legs or walls. The smart mapping system is another feature that makes the S9 stand out. The vSLAM technology scans the whole room and creates a virtual map of it. This allows it to navigate more efficiently, and eliminates long running times due to missing sections of the room. It also features enhanced cliff detection, which stops the robot from falling down stairs or sliding on slippery or wet surfaces. The loudness of this model is among its biggest shortcomings. It's louder than other models we have tested, and it can be difficult to maintain a conversation while the S9 is in operation. This is especially true when the turbo mode is turned on, which sounds like a jet taking off. However, the S9+'s powerful brushes and navigation systems that are based on sensors make it a fantastic option for busy families. It's even able to clean when you're away from home, and it will automatically return to its base to recharge when the battery is low.
